Seems to be rated quite highly 'next matt jarvis' by these Sunderland fans.
I agree,and he has fairly similar strengths and weaknesses. Lots of pace, his delivery is fairly good, but sometimes takes the wrong option and is sometimes slow to control the ball when he first receives it. At this level, he usually receives the ball in a fair amount of space, so I'm going to be really interested to see how he fares at the next level.He reminds me of Steve Mcmanaman when he played for Liverpool. As soon as he got the ball, the defenders immediatley start back pedalling, great to watch.
